Output 592b626729a60c3602282c4d4be76dad4af07ffd68b2a7e8ade3cdf2767d7aed:5

value
2626422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1597d4b6de1ab9e2fd27dfd611c428985648d10 OP_EQUAL
address
3Ph9ycK5tM5nUdPZt1eDRzW1KBoymk7cRB
transaction
592b626729a60c3602282c4d4be76dad4af07ffd68b2a7e8ade3cdf2767d7aed
spent
true